Luminous Stones are used for one primary purpose in The Legend of Zelda: Tears of the Kingdom. It is used as a crafting material to upgrade different types of equipment and clothing for Link. This is useful, as there aren’t many avenues for upgrading gear within the game. Though, before you can use a Luminous Stone, you have to get a Luminous Stone. This guide can help you learn how. How To Get Luminous Stone

Luminous Stone in Zelda Tears of the Kingdom
Screenshot via The Nerd Stash (The Legend of Zelda: Tears of the Kingdom)

Luminous Stone can be found in a couple of different ways in Zelda Tears of the Kingdom. The first and most common way is by breaking rocks. Typically, if a rock that you can break for a Luminous Stone, it glows blue toward the top of it. You can break these rocks by using a bludgeoning-type weapon. One that works well is any sword with a boulder fused to it.

These Luminous boulders can be found all over Hyrule but are more commonly found in caves. They can also drop from specific enemies throughout the world and can be found in chests too.

How To Use Luminous Stone in Zelda Tears of the Kingdom

Luminous Stone is primarily used for upgrading gear. This is how certain pieces are upgraded, like the Radiant Mask or the Tunic of Awakening. Below, you can learn how to make each of them.

  • Radiant Mask
    • 10x Luminous Stone
    • 1x Bokoblin Guts
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 starts
    • 20 Armor at 4 stars
  • Radiant Tights
    • 10x Luminous Stone
    • 1x Bokoblin Guts
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 stars
    • 20 Armor at 4 stars
  • Radiant Shirt
    • 10x Luminous Stone
    • 1x Bokoblin Guts
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 stars
    • 20 Armor at 4 stars
  • Mask of Awakening
    • 10x luminous Stone
    • 1x Star Fragment
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 stars
    • 20 Armor at 4 stars
  • Trousers of Awakening
    • 10x Luminous Stone
    • 1x Star Fragment
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 stars
    • 20 Armor at 20 stars
  • Tunic of Awakening
    • 10x Luminous Stone
    • 1x Star Fragment
    • 10x Rupee
    • 5 Armor at 1 star
    • 8 Armor at 2 stars
    • 12 Armor at 3 stars
    • 20 Armor at 4 stars
